(© Joseph Marzullo/WENN) | Full casting has been announced for Carlyle Brown's Pure Confidence, to play Mixed Blood Theatre in Minneapolis, January 15-February 1, with an opening on January 16. Tony nominee Marion McClinton will direct.
The play is set against a backdrop of fast horses, gritty racetracks, and high stakes betting, and tells the tale of one of the most successful athletes of his day -- Simon Cato, a slave. The play will feature Gavin Lawrence, Regina Williams, Mark Sieve, Karen Landry, and Chris Mulkey.
McClinton received a Tony nomination for his direction of August Wilson's King Hedley II, and additional Main Stem credits include Ma Rainey's Black Bottom and Drowning Crow. He received a Drama Desk nomination for his production of Jitney. He will also direct Samuel Beckett's Endgame for Ten Thousand Things Theater Company in Minneapolis later this season.
